I know the use of AI is frowned upon but I'm curious about how it's done? Are there even any advantages to using ai for a translation romhack compared to doing it the traditional way?
 
As with a lot of things, it depends on how you use AI itself for the project.

You could ask for it to make the patch directly, script included. Entirely possible in some cases depending on how the game files are stored internally, but the quality will be sorely lacking if no proof-reading is done while comparing it to a trustworthy script.

Ideally, you'd want AI to assist you with making the tools that you'd use to insert the game text yourself and then repacking it into the game proper. That way you'd avoid years of learning to code while still guaranteeing that the final script would be something you approved.
 
As far as i know, the hacking part (like extracting and re-inserting the texts of the game) is still done the traditional way... though AI might be used to help creating the necessary tools.
(I'm not sure how useful it might be in that area)

The main part that is done by AI is translating the text.

Actually it's nothing new... using tools such as Google Translate has been pretty common in the translation scene.

In the past, romhackers should have had to find a human translator to take care of translation, while the romhacker would focus on the hacking parts...
However, it wasn't uncommon that either the translator or romhacker would stop working on it, and the project would become dead...

What has changed now is that AI can produce a level of acceptable quality of translation... while the older tools wasn't able to do so.

Thanks to it, the bottleneck of coupling a human translator and a romhacker is lifted.
Romhackers can prepare the translation tools, and provide a bare bone translation using AI, and leave the quality work and polishing to anyone with translation skills who are able to do so.
